I think I just had my first flash mob experience tonight. Gin and I just finished dinner on Kingsland Rd (where you go for ‘pho’) and we went to Liverpool Street Station to catch the train home. Now you have to remember this station is busy. It’s kinda like a Flinders Street except 5 times as big and 10 times as busy (you can’t walk a straight line from one end to the other during peak hour). It was just jam packed with people screaming, jumping, etc. Police were on site too and I did hear an announcement towards the end over the PA asking the people to clear/leave the station immediately. Unfortunately as a result of this ‘event’ (whatever it was), they also ended up closing Liverpool Street Station for whatever reason and we ended up having to walk to Moorgate to catch a tube home.

My gosh… new record for me I think. Haven’t posted in almost 3 months!!! (And yet I’m still ahead in the total post count).

Anyway, went out for my mid-week ride today, doing some hill repeats as per last week. I don’t know what it is but I seem to be very consistent when it comes to a lot of my rides. Considering I had about 6km of traffic to deal with, it still took me almost exactly the same time to the second as my last week’s attempt.

Some other examples of my consistent performance (or lack thereof).

  • Time trial course I did 2 years ago in Melbourne. My first leg out was almost identical to the second again as my return leg back.
  • My regular commutes into work is usually +/-30 seconds apart from the commute back home, despite the hundreds of traffic lights that I have to deal with.

And it’s not like I try to time them that way. I just don’t look at the elapsed time figures until I get home.

Is there an explanation for this?? Or am I really just consistently slack?
